Introduction: Amla, also known as Indian gooseberry, and honey are two natural ingredients that have long been recognized for their health benefits. When combined, they create a potent elixir with even greater advantages. Honey-soaked amla is a traditional Ayurvedic preparation that offers a wide range of health benefits. In this blog post, we will explore the incredible health benefits of honey-soaked amla and provide practical tips on how to incorporate it into your daily routine.

  1. Immune System Support: Amla is renowned for its high vitamin C content, which strengthens the immune system and helps fight off infections. Honey, with its antibacterial properties, enhances this effect. Together, honey-soaked amla becomes a powerful defense against common illnesses like colds, flu, and respiratory infections.
  2. Digestive Health: Both amla and honey have been used for centuries to promote digestive well-being. Amla's mild laxative properties aid in smooth bowel movements and prevent constipation. Honey, being a prebiotic, supports the growth of beneficial gut bacteria. Consuming honey-soaked amla can help regulate digestion and promote a healthy gut.
  3. Antioxidant Powerhouse: Amla is rich in antioxidants like vitamin C, polyphenols, and flavonoids. These compounds protect the body against free radicals and oxidative stress. When combined with honey, honey-soaked amla becomes an excellent source of antioxidants, reducing inflammation and supporting overall cellular health.
  4. Skin and Hair Health: The combination of amla and honey works wonders for your skin and hair. Amla's high vitamin C content promotes collagen production, resulting in healthy, youthful-looking skin. Honey's moisturizing and antibacterial properties help combat acne, soothe irritation, and provide a natural glow. Applying honey-soaked amla paste or consuming it internally nourishes the skin and contributes to lustrous hair.
  5. Heart Health: Regular consumption of honey-soaked amla can benefit your cardiovascular system. Amla helps lower cholesterol levels, reduce blood pressure, and improve blood circulation. The antioxidants in amla and the cardiovascular benefits of honey work together to support a healthy heart.
